Metros sending the most people to Brownsville
Stacker compiled a list of metros that are sending the most people to Brownsville using data from the U.S. Census Bureau. Metros are ranked by the estimated number of people who moved to Brownsville from the metro between 2014 and 2018. Ties were broken by gross migration.
